#32111e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32111e is composed of 19.6% red, 6.7%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 40%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 336.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 13.1%. #32111e color hex could be obtained by blending #64223c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#32111e color description : Very dark (mostly black) pink.
#32111e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32111e has RGB values of R:50, G:17,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.4,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3281182.
